SVGOptions

SVGOptions class

Stellt eine SVG-Option dar.

public sealed class SVGOptions : SaveOptions, ISVGOptions

Konstrukteure

NameBeschreibung
SVGOptions()Initialisiert eine neue Instanz der SVGOptions-Klasse.
SVGOptions(ILinkEmbedController)Initialisiert eine neue Instanz der SVGOptions-Klasse, die das Link-Embedding-Controller-Objekt angibt.

Eigenschaften

NameBeschreibung
static Default { get; }Gibt Standardeinstellungen zurück. SchreibgeschütztSVGOptions .
static Simple { get; }Gibt Einstellungen für die einfachste und kleinste Generierung von SVG-Dateien zurück. SchreibgeschütztSVGOptions .
static WYSIWYG { get; }Gibt Einstellungen für die genaueste Generierung von SVG-Dateien zurück. SchreibgeschütztSVGOptions .
DefaultRegularFont { get; set; }Gibt die verwendete Schriftart zurück oder legt sie fest, falls die Quellschriftart nicht gefunden wird. Lesen/SchreibenString .
DeletePicturesCroppedAreas { get; set; }Ein boolesches Flag gibt an, ob die abgeschnittenen Teile Teil des Dokuments bleiben. Wenn wahr, werden die abgeschnittenen Teile entfernt, wenn falsch, werden sie im Dokument serialisiert (was möglicherweise zu einer größeren Datei führen kann)
Disable3DText { get; set; }Legt fest, ob der 3D-Text in SVG deaktiviert ist. Lesen/SchreibenBoolean .
DisableGradientSplit { get; set; }Deaktiviert das Teilen von FromCornerX- und FromCenter-Verläufen. Lesen/SchreibenBoolean .
DisableLineEndCropping { get; set; }SVG 1.1 kann keine Einfügungen für Markierungen definieren. Die SVG-Schreibmaschine Aspose.Slides hat eine Problemumgehung für dieses Problem: Das Zeilenende wird mit einem Pfeil abgeschnitten, sodass die Linie die Markierungen nicht überlappt. Diese Option schaltet dieses Verhalten aus. Lesen/SchreibenBoolean .
ExternalFontsHandling { get; set; }Legt fest, wie mit extern geladenen Schriftarten umgegangen wird. Lesen/SchreibenSvgExternalFontsHandling .
JpegQuality { get; set; }Legt die Qualität der JPEG-Codierung fest. Lesen/SchreibenInt32 .
MetafileRasterizationDpi { get; set; }Gibt die untere Auflösungsgrenze für die Metadatei-Rasterung zurück oder legt sie fest. Lesen/SchreibenInt32 .
PicturesCompression { get; set; }Stellt die Komprimierungsstufe der Bilder dar
ProgressCallback { get; set; }Repräsentiert ein Callback-Objekt zum Speichern von Fortschrittsaktualisierungen in Prozent. SieheIProgressCallback .
ShapeFormattingController { get; set; }Gibt eine Callback-Schnittstelle zurück und legt sie fest, mit der der Benutzer die Formkonvertierung steuern kann. Lesen/SchreibenISvgShapeFormattingController .
VectorizeText { get; set; }Legt fest, ob der Text auf einer Folie als Grafik gespeichert wird. Lesen/SchreibenBoolean .
WarningCallback { get; set; }Gibt ein Objekt zurück, das Warnungen empfängt und entscheidet, ob der Ladevorgang fortgesetzt oder abgebrochen wird. Lesen/SchreibenIWarningCallback .

Siehe auch